Open McAfee. Click the “ Navigation ” link in the right pane of the McAfee window and then click “ General Settings and Alerts ” under Settings. Click the “ Informational Alerts ” and “ Protection Alerts ” categories, and then uncheck types of alert messages you don’t want to see. However, this method can’t remove pop-ups ...1. Mar 15, 2024 · 2. The Fake McAfee “Your PC Is Infected” Virus Warning. The scam page then generates an alert designed to precisely mimic the branding of McAfee Total Protection security software. This includes: McAfee and Total Protection logos. A fake scanning animation claiming to check “commonly infected areas and startup files”. The first step in addressing Mcafee pop-ups on Chrome is to disable any Mcafee browser extensions that may be contributing to the issue. To do this, navigate to the Chrome menu, select "More tools," and then click on "Extensions." Locate the Mcafee extension in the list and toggle the switch to disable it.
